General Rules:

  1. Respect: Respect is an essential thing. Even if your partner is not facing you, it does not relieve you of the responsibility to be respectful towards them. Defamatory, racist, sexual and other breaches of the code of ethics will be severely punished. The administration reserves the right to ban any person who engage in such acts on the spot. Although the staff are the main referees, they are however not above the law. For any abuse on their part, do not hesitate to report it to either Seishin, Sayuri or Kazuki (with supporting evidence).
  2. Writing and roleplaying: A minimum of ten solid lines (excluding dialogues) are required for a roleplay post to be considered as accepted. This is done in order to maintain a certain level of quality in the roleplay. Remember that you write for yourself, but also for others. So be sure to write the correct way. It is not allowed to double post, and you're not allowed to edit your post unless your roleplay partner(s) allow(s) it. See, if your character is fighting another character, you should not edit your posts without asking your opponent first. This is to ensure that people are not editing their posts after making a mistake to get an advantage. Think twice before you post.
  3. Metagaming: Do not metagame. Metagaming can be defined as any out of character action made by a player's character which makes use of knowledge that the character is not meant to be aware of. Roleplay with your character based on the information given in the application. Do not change his personality whenever you see fit. If your character is serious and cold do make a fun topic where goes out making jokes. It is mandatory that you separate the actions, thoughts and other things for your character, using colors, dashes, quotes, or anything else that serves for this purpose.
  4. Combat: We try to govern the battles with our mana pools and systems but there is another essential key is required which is fair play. It is obvious that characters get tired anyway in their battles. This is why we ask our members to be humble in this process and logical. It is not important to win constantly. Defeat is an integral part of any character. Metagaming and godmodding is not allowed. In those cases that a dispute occurs, the moderators and administrators will serve as arbitrator. Try to be mature, if the mentioned arguments clearly show that you're not right, don't get a moderator or administrator involved. In some cases it might even result into an punishment. Death is possible if both parties agree that it is a possibility in the thread. Some plot threads might be deadly but this information will be placed somewhere very visible for the possible visitors to read so that they enter at their own discretion.
  5. Graphics: In order to not distort the pages for all players, the maximum size for avatars is set at 150 pixels width and 300 pixels height. It is required to have an avatar before you roleplay. The avatar must be an image of your appearance. Signatures must not exceed 450 pixels width and 150 pixels height. It is only allowed to have one signature image. Any breach of this rule will result in the removal of images and possibly lowering the member's warning bar.
  6. Advertising: Any advertising for another forum is prohibited. The only area where it is tolerated is the Advertisement section. Any breach of this rule will result into an immediate ban of the member who violated this rule. This means advertising in other sections, through private messages, mentioning other forums in the chatbox and sharing urls directing to other forums.
  7. Accounts: The username must match your character's full name. Every account has an unique face claim, this can not be changed later on so pick your appearance wisely. A member is allowed to have multiple characters, but each character requires a separate account. A member can only have one account with a limited magic (such as Requip or Dragon Slayer). When a character dies the account will get locked. All characters must be humans. Anything other than human requires admin approval.
  8. Guilds: It is highly frowned upon to leave your guild. While in some cases it may be the result of a character's growth, it is usually not respectful towards the guild you chose in the first place. To compensate this a mandatory payment has to be done whenever a member decides to leave their guild. The starting fee to leave is 100,000J, this doubles every time you do it again. Pick your guilds wisely when you start. In case you want to try out a new guild, consider a new character.
  9. Chatbox: Do not start any fights or get yourself involved when someone is provoking you. Behave properly in the chatbox. Everyone involved in the fight will get chatbox banned. Do not whine or complain in the chatbox. Complaints can be PMed to the administrators. Do not advertise in the chatbox. It's difficult to set this bar so any reference to other forums will be considered as advertising. Do not use codes to alter the chatbox color or font. No sexual conversations in the chatbox. This goes into the PMs.
  10. Limitation: Characters can only be in three threads at the same time. These threads must be in the same town. So it is possible to be going on a mission in one thread, while having a romantic dinner in another thread as long as it's in the same town. Once you leave a town you must exit all your threads in that town first.
